Performance

The fund has returned 11.79 percent over the past year, 11.28 percent over the past three years, 4.44 percent over the past five years, and 5.32 percent over the past decade.

Summary

The investment seeks investment results, before fees and expenses, that correspond to the performance of the S&P 500® Growth Index (the "index"). The fund invests in equity securities that the adviser believes, in combination, should have similar return characteristics as the return of the index. The index is designed to provide a comprehensive measure of large-cap U.S. equity "growth" performance. It is an unmanaged float-adjusted market capitalization weighted index comprising of stocks representing approximately half the market capitalization of the S&P 500 that have been identified as being on the growth end of the growth-value spectrum.
